HORNBACH Holding
Trading Statement for the 2020/2021 Financial Year
Hornbach Group maintains growth course in first nine months of 2020/21: Nine-month consolidated sales rise 20.2% to Euro 4.5 billion / Adjusted EBIT increases 67.2% to Euro 401.5 million / Annual forecast confirmed despite lockdown risks
Susanne Jäger and Albrecht Hornbach appointed for further five years – CFO Roland Pelka to hand over to his successor Karin Dohm on April 1, 2021.
The Hornbach Holding AG & Co. KGaA Group (Hornbach Group) has maintained its growth course in the fall of 2020. The Board of Management is raising the sales and earnings forecast for 2020/21 to account for the very pleasing sales and earnings performance in the first eight months of the current financial year.

DIY store operator to merge Germany and Group administration once the measures to extend and refurbish its main headquarters are complete / Around 280 employees set to move from Neustadt an der Weinstrasse to Bornheim / Tenants sought for building in Neustadt

Hornbach thanks its customers on the 50th anniversary of opening its first DIY store and garden center / Starting immediately, the permanent low price policy will apply 30 days after purchase as well / German stores are holding numerous workshops and presentations to mark the event
